Hidden Fall

Located right next to the immensely popular Skogafoss waterfall, I read online that if you parked near a museum, climbed over a fence, and walked through a farmer’s field, you would find the hidden gem of a waterfall, Kvernufoss. I was definitely not disappointed. The surrounding canyon was lush and saturated with mist from the waterfall and there was a crystal clear stream running away from it towards the ocean. It was quite an incredible sight and I was grateful to only be sharing it with a couple taking wedding photos.
